ajaynegi45/LibraryMan-API

[BUG] Null Values Returned for Book and Member When Borrowing a Book

Opened this issue · 8 comments

Is this a new issue?

  • I have searched "open" and "closed" issues, and this is not a duplicate.

Bug Description

When borrowing a book via the POST request to http://localhost:8080/api/borrowings, the response contains null values for both the book and member details. The expected behavior is to return the complete details of the book and member, but instead, the following response is received:

{
    "borrowingId": 1,
    "book": {
        "bookId": 2,
        "title": null,
        "author": null,
        "isbn": null,
        "publisher": null,
        "publishedYear": 0,
        "genre": null,
        "copiesAvailable": 0
    },
    "fine": null,
    "member": {
        "memberId": 2,
        "name": null,
        "email": null,
        "password": null,
        "role": null,
        "membershipDate": null
    },
    "borrowDate": "2024-09-05T17:37:49.623+00:00",
    "dueDate": "2024-09-20T17:37:49.623+00:00",
    "returnDate": null
}

Steps to Reproduce

  1. Borrow a book by sending a POST request to http://localhost:8080/api/borrowings with valid book and member data.
  2. Check the response body for book and member details.

Expected Behavior

  • The response should contain the correct book and member details, such as title, author, ISBN, and member name, email, etc.

I want to work on this issue with the label gssoc. Could you please assign me this .

I want to work on this issue with the label gssoc. Could you please assign me this .

Hi @shreyamaheshwari1,

Thank you for expressing your interest in working on the "Null Values Returned for Book and Member When Borrowing a Book" issue. I'm delighted to inform you that I have assigned this issue to you. Your willingness to contribute to our project is much appreciated.

Feel free to start working, and if you have any questions or need assistance during the process, please don't hesitate to reach out.

Hello Sir, Could you please assign me this issue.

Hello Sir, Could you please assign me this issue.

Hi @Shetu003,

Thank you for expressing your interest in working on the "Null Values Returned for Book and Member When Borrowing a Book" issue. However, this issue is currently being worked on by another contributor, shreyamaheshwari1 . You can explore other issues in our repository or check out our other projects under the GirlScript Summer of Code and Hacktoberfest.

Here are the links to explore:
https://bento.me/ajaynegi

Feel free to reach out if you have any questions or need guidance on where to start. We're excited to have your contributions!

Hi Sir ,I would love to work on this issue with the GSSoC label. Could you kindly assign it to me, please?

Hello @ajaynegi45 sir ,
Sir can this be considered as Level1 the pr has been merged already ?

Hello @ajaynegi45 sir , Sir can this be considered as Level1 the pr has been merged already ?
@shreyamaheshwari1
No the pr is not merged

@ajaynegi45 kindly assign work to me sir